A Libyan citizen stranded in the Gaza Strip has appealed to the authorities to get her and her children out as soon as possible, according to a video circulating on social media.
Souad Al-Ahmar addressed the head of the Government of National Unity, Abdul Hamid Dbeibah, to intervene and help her to leave Gaza.
Al-Ahmar said that she sent her documents to the embassy, asking for government intervention to complete some procedures, saying: “We are almost sitting in the street,” considering that the situation in Gaza is terrible.
